Vous êtes ici Forums
  |  Connexion
 Forums
HomeHomeForums DNNForums DNNDéveloppementDéveloppementAstuce : Forcer la réinitialisation complète de lAstuce : Forcer la réinitialisation complète de l'index de recherche
Précédente
 
Suivante
Nouveau message
28/10/2008 14:09
 

Il peut être utile de forcer la mise à jour de l’ensemble du contenu indexé par le moteur de recherche Dotnetnuke, lorsque par exemple vous travaillez sur un module qui implémente ISearcheable et que vous tâtonnez, ou lorsque vous constatez simplement que le résultat d'une recherche est imparfait.

Pour ce faire, rendez-vous sur la page Hôte > SQL, et lancez le script suivant :

truncate table {databaseOwner}{objectQualifier}SearchItemWordPosition
DELETE {databaseOwner}{objectQualifier}SearchItemWord
DELETE {databaseOwner}{objectQualifier}SearchWord
DELETE {databaseOwner}{objectQualifier}SearchItem

(via deutschnetnuke..de)



Puis pour ré-indexer le contenu, vous pouvez au choix :

  • Attendre que la tâche planifiée d’indexation se lance toute seule (toutes les 30 minutes par défaut),
  • Provoquer manuellement la ré-indexation : Rendez-vous sur la page Hôte > Indexation, et cliquez sur “Ré-indexer le contenu”.

Seb

 
Précédente
 
Suivante
HomeHomeForums DNNForums DNNDéveloppementDéveloppementAstuce : Forcer la réinitialisation complète de lAstuce : Forcer la réinitialisation complète de l'index de recherche